Understanding the Mechanics of Kalshi Markets
At its core, operates as a designated exchange regulated by the Commodity Futures Trading Commission (CFTC). This regulatory framework ensures a level of transparency and security not always present in other prediction markets. Users don't trade directly on the outcome of an event. Instead, they buy and sell contracts representing a specific outcome, with the payout tied to the actual result. This structure transforms forecasting into a financial transaction, aligning incentives more effectively. For example, a market might exist for the question of whether the US unemployment rate will be below 4% in December. Traders can buy “Yes” contracts, betting the rate will be below 4%, or “No” contracts, betting it will be at or above 4%. The price of these contracts dynamically adjusts based on supply and demand, representing the market's collective belief about the probability of each outcome.
The Role of Liquidity and Market Depth
The accuracy and efficiency of markets are heavily influenced by liquidity – the ease with which contracts can be bought and sold. Higher liquidity typically leads to tighter spreads (the difference between the buying and selling price) and more accurate price discovery. Market depth, referring to the volume of outstanding buy and sell orders at various price levels, is equally important. A deep market can absorb large trades without significantly impacting the price, further enhancing stability and reliability. Kalshi actively works to attract a diverse range of participants, including individual traders, institutional investors, and researchers, to cultivate both liquidity and depth within its markets. This also ensures a wider range of perspectives contribute to the overall accuracy of the predictions.

Applications of Kalshi in Economic Forecasting
The applications of -style markets extend far beyond simply predicting election outcomes. In the realm of economics, these platforms can provide valuable insights into areas like inflation expectations, GDP growth forecasts, and even the success or failure of specific government policies. For instance, a market could be created to predict whether the Federal Reserve will raise interest rates by a certain date. The price movements within that market would reflect the collective view of traders regarding the likelihood of such a move, offering a real-time gauge of market expectations. This information can be incredibly valuable for investors, policymakers, and businesses alike, allowing them to anticipate and prepare for potential economic shifts. The speed at which information is incorporated into market prices is a distinct advantage over traditional survey-based forecasting methods.

Kalshi and Traditional Economic Forecasting Methods
Traditional economic forecasting relies heavily on econometric models, surveys, and expert opinions. These methods each have their own strengths and weaknesses. Econometric models, while capable of analyzing large datasets, are often based on assumptions that may not hold true in the real world. Surveys can be subject to bias, as respondents may not always accurately report their true beliefs or intentions. Expert opinions, while valuable, are often influenced by individual biases and limited perspectives. offers a complementary approach, leveraging the "wisdom of the crowd" to generate forecasts based on collective intelligence. It doesn't necessarily aim to replace traditional methods, but rather to augment them, providing a valuable check on existing forecasts and uncovering potential blind spots.
Comparing Accuracy and Timeliness
Several studies have shown that prediction markets, including platforms like Kalshi, can outperform traditional forecasting methods in terms of accuracy, particularly in the short to medium term. This is attributed to the incentive structure that encourages traders to incorporate all available information into their decisions. Furthermore, Kalshi markets offer a level of timeliness that is often lacking in traditional forecasting. Prices adjust in real-time as new information becomes available, providing an immediate reflection of market sentiment. Traditional methods, by contrast, often involve a lengthy process of data collection, model building, and analysis, resulting in forecasts that may be outdated by the time they are released. The ability to react quickly to changing circumstances is a significant advantage in today’s rapidly evolving economic environment.

Challenges and Future Developments for Prediction Markets
Despite its potential, the widespread adoption of prediction markets like faces several challenges. One key issue is accessibility. Currently, participation is limited to individuals in certain jurisdictions and requires a basic understanding of financial markets. Expanding access to a broader audience will be crucial for realizing the full potential of these platforms. Another challenge is the potential for manipulation. While Kalshi has implemented measures to prevent fraud and manipulation, it remains a concern. Continued development of robust security protocols and regulatory oversight will be essential for maintaining market integrity. Educating the public about the benefits of prediction markets and addressing common misconceptions is also important.
Looking ahead, we can expect to see continued innovation in the design and functionality of prediction markets. This includes the development of more sophisticated contract structures, improved risk management tools, and enhanced user interfaces. Furthermore, the integration of artificial intelligence and machine learning could help to identify patterns and anomalies in market data, further improving forecasting accuracy. The potential for collaboration between prediction markets and traditional forecasting institutions is also significant. By combining the strengths of both approaches, we can create a more comprehensive and robust system for economic analysis and decision-making.
Beyond Economic Indicators: Novel Applications of Predictive Markets
The utility of platforms like Kalshi isn't limited to traditional economic indicators. Consider the application to supply chain risk assessment. A market could be constructed around the probability of a major disruption at a key port, or a shortage of a critical component. The real-time pricing in such a market would provide businesses with an early warning signal, allowing them to adjust their inventory levels and sourcing strategies proactively. Similarly, in the realm of technological innovation, a market could predict the likelihood of a successful product launch or the adoption rate of a new technology. This could be invaluable for venture capitalists, corporate strategists, and even policymakers seeking to foster innovation. The ability to quantify uncertainty and assess risk in these areas represents a significant advancement over traditional methods.
